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/visual-studio-2008/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 如何使用批处理文件以管理员身份运行MStest_C#_Visual Studio 2008_Command Line_Automated Tests_Mstest - Fatal编程技术网

C# 如何使用批处理文件以管理员身份运行MStest

C# 如何使用批处理文件以管理员身份运行MStest,c#,visual-studio-2008,command-line,automated-tests,mstest,C#,Visual Studio 2008,Command Line,Automated Tests,Mstest,我正在尝试使用批处理文件运行一些自动测试。我在VSTS 2008中编写了所有这些测试用例。当我使用VSIDE运行这些测试用例时,它成功地运行了。但一旦我尝试使用批处理文件运行测试用例,它就会抛出错误“System.ComponentModel.Win32Exception:请求的操作需要提升” 根据我的理解,如果我们可以作为管理员运行VS命令提示符,这将解决我的问题。因此,你能帮我“如何从批处理文件中以管理员身份运行VS cmd”吗。我已经使用了这个runas/user:\username cm

我正在尝试使用批处理文件运行一些自动测试。我在VSTS 2008中编写了所有这些测试用例。当我使用VSIDE运行这些测试用例时,它成功地运行了。但一旦我尝试使用批处理文件运行测试用例,它就会抛出错误“System.ComponentModel.Win32Exception:请求的操作需要提升”

根据我的理解,如果我们可以作为管理员运行VS命令提示符,这将解决我的问题。因此,你能帮我“如何从批处理文件中以管理员身份运行VS cmd”吗。我已经使用了这个runas/user:\username cmd,但它并不能解决我的问题。

我得到了答案——我已经创建了批处理文件。然后我创建了这个批处理文件的一个快捷方式。然后在这个快捷方式文件的高级属性中,我将其设置为以管理员身份打开。这样就解决了我的问题。所有测试用例都可以从批处理文件中正常运行。

我得到了答案——我已经创建了批处理文件。然后我创建了这个批处理文件的一个快捷方式。然后在这个快捷方式文件的高级属性中,我将其设置为以管理员身份打开。这样就解决了我的问题。所有测试用例都可以从批处理文件中正常运行